  • In this video I showcase my recently acquired Epiphone Inspired Byy Gibson Explorer 1958 Korina Reissue. I found this guitar used at a good price and decided I would trade a couple of guitars I no longer needed or wanted for it, after falling in love with the looks and tone of this monstrous guitar. This particular model only weighs 6 pounds 14 ounces and sings like a bird. I was totally blown away with the tone as well as appearance. In the video I provide a full review and professionally recorded audio recording so you can see and hear what it sounds like. What do you think? Have Epihpone lost their mind for selling these guitars for $1299 retail? It certainly is a lot less expensive than the Gibson version that is $9999.99.
